Make a chandelier using a hanging plant basket and some beaded strings! This easy and mess-free DIY is perfect for hiding ugly light fixtures without rewiring. Visit http://www.hammerandheelsblog.com/diy-chandelier/ for the full tutorial and more photos.
Materials:


- 12-inch-diameter hanging wire plant basket (adjust the basket size if your fixture is smaller or larger)


- silver spray paint


- four 6-foot strings of decorative crystal garland for a total of 24 feet (I found mine at Michaels)


- three metal hanging hooks or whatever you prefer to attach the plant basket to your old light fixture
First, spray paint the plant basket silver and let dry. Then begin weaving the beaded garlands through the plant basket until it's covered and that's it!
I found these hooks that attached perfect to the old fixture.
